How to be a Happier Parent: Raising a Family, Having a Life, and Loving (Almost) Every Minute by K.J. Dell'Antonia

4.0

A worthwhile parenting read. Refrains from preaching, but instead offers mantras that can be called upon in so many different parenting circumstances. I especially appreciated the chapter on discipline and her reminder that when kids make mistakes, it should not be felt as a parenting failure or personal affront, but an opportunity to teach and help our children grow.
